Hello!

I'm a newbie to the MikroTik world (and to VLANs) trying to build a proper homelab. My knowledge/experience of Mikrotik CLI is null, but I have some experience with linux and freebsd.

I have 2 servers (pfSense routers) that are connected between each other through the SFP+ 1 and 2 ports of a MikroTik CRS328-24P-4S+RM24. The servers communicated properly without VLANs (default VLAN 1), but when I implement bridge VLAN Tables (SFP1 and SFP2 as tagged trunks and some ethernet access ports as untagged), the servers cannon communicate between each other (no ping, no nothing). Interestingly, the untagged ethernet ports work fine, just the trunks seem to not communicate between each other. My final goal is to properly and securely segregate my network, everything „managed” (DHCP, internet access, firewall etc.) by the 2 pfSense routers that are in a High Availability configuration.

pfSense1 <---trunk---> MikroTik CRS328-24P-4S+RM24 <---trunk---> pfSense2

Is the „Switch Rules” menu of the MikroTik something I should read further or perhaps something else?



Thank you in advance for any help!

For a CRS3xx you should configure a single VLAN-aware bridge which utilises L2 hardware offloading, see https://help.mikrotik.com/docs/display/ ... NFiltering and viewtopic.php?t=143620

You need to add or change settings under /interface bridge (Bridge > Bridge), /interface bridge port (Bridge > Ports) and /interface bridge vlan (Bridge > VLANs).

Switch rules are only required to filter or modify packets passing through the switch chip.
